Audemars Piguet Royal Oak Lady Automatic – Stainless Steel | Reference 8638ST

A Rare and Historic Lady Royal Oak from the 1970s

This vintage Audemars Piguet Royal Oak Lady Automatic, Reference 8638ST, represents the very first Royal Oak designed specifically for women. Introduced in 1976, the 8638 carried forward the revolutionary design language of the 5402 “Jumbo” of 1972, reinterpreted in a refined 29 mm case suited for a female clientele.

Crafted entirely in stainless steel, the case remains exceptionally sharp, with crisp bevels and the iconic octagonal bezel featuring exposed screws. The integrated bracelet, also in steel, is long and accommodates a wrist size of approximately 17–17.5 cm—rare for this reference and highly desirable for collectors.

Powered by the Self-Winding Calibre 2062

At its heart is the Audemars Piguet Calibre 2062, a compact yet robust self-winding movement based on a LeCoultre ébauche, celebrated for its slim architecture and reliability. This movement has benefited from multiple services over the years, supported by a wealth of accompanying documentation.

Brown Tropical Dial – Even and Beautifully Aged

The original dial has aged into a completely even tropical brown tone, lending the watch a warmth and individuality that can only develop over decades. Applied tritium hour markers and hands remain intact, adding depth and vintage character.

Historical Significance

  • Introduced 1976: The first Royal Oak for women, expanding the Royal Oak family beyond the original 5402.

  • Production: Approximately 3,889 pieces produced, mainly between 1976–1980, with sales extending into the early 1990s.

  • Variants: Initially offered in steel, later joined by two-tone and precious metal executions.

Key Specifications

  • Reference: 8638ST (Stainless Steel)

  • Case: 29 mm, sharp stainless steel construction, sapphire crystal

  • Movement: Audemars Piguet Cal. 2062 – automatic, serviced

  • Dial: Brown tropical, evenly aged, with tritium markers and hands

  • Bracelet: Integrated stainless steel, approx. 17–17.5 cm wrist size

  • Crown: Original signed AP crown
